Printpack, a leading manufacturer of flexible packaging products, is seeking qualified candidates to fill a Slitter Operator position at their Villa Rica II facility located in Villa Rica, Georgia.
Qualified candidates should have experience in an industrial manufacturing environment.
Pay: $21.08 - $31.62 per hour depending on experience
Plus an additional $2.50 per hour for the night shift premium.
Schedule: Night Shift 8:00pm – 8:00am on a 3/2 schedule
Training will be on days for the first few months
Benefits:
Medical, Dental, Vision, Life – after 30 days of employment
401K with company match
Hourly Bonus Program
Tuition Reimbursement
Annual reviews with a potential for a pay rate increase
Up to $120 for steel toed shoes
Up to $135 for uniforms
Up to $125 for prescription safety glasses
Overtime
Minimum Requirements:
High School Diploma or GED equivalent
Must be at least 18 years old
At least 1 year of experience operating a machine is preferred
Internal Candidates:
Last performance review was rated “Performer” or higher
No disciplinary actions beyond a written within the past 120 days
Must be in current position for at least 120 days.
Job Responsibilities:
Prepare master rolls for slitting
Place rolls in machine and prepare for splicing
Properly segregate and label all materials
Ensure your own safety while operating the machine and that of those assisting with operations
Communicate orally and/or in writing to other departments for resolution of mechanical problems, reporting defective material, coordination of job preparations, changeovers and daily shift information
Ability to troubleshoot if needed

Printpack is one of the most innovative and progressive packaging companies in the world and it embodies the employee-centric values established by its founder, J. Erskine Love Jr. in 1956.
Printpack’s competition can buy the same equipment and materials, but the difference has always been the people who walk their plant floors and stroll through their hallways. There is no question that Printpack’s associates are a major factor in why their customers have faithfully relied on the Printpack level of service for over 60 years.
